[QUOTE="MTCoins123, post: 1660176, member: 45553"]Yes i understamd it is damaged (altered) in some way ,Thanks. Also i agree there is nothing, to my knowledge, in the process of striking a coin that would cause such a change. In the research i did i came across "Heat blistered" Coins. From what i gathered heat blisters are caused by minute gas bubbles caught between the layers of Clad coins, in a coin made of a single metal a blister is extremely unlikely, i would assume if a single blister is unlikely then this type of blistering would be nearly impossible and on a coin that is not clad it should be impossible. I do agree that it does fit the description of an alteration caused by heat though, i would have to say though that it would also require some serious deviation from the purity of a standard seated half, either a counterfeit made from a substandard metal or a substandard planchet at the mint for some reason. In my personal experience i have melted many types of metals and have never seen a metal (a consistent alloy) blister, not even a single small blister. I Guess if we assume it is a heat damaged coin then i would like to know what conditions would the metal need to meet in order for this extreme blistering to happen? Or, did the seated half ever get made from any type of "clad" planchet's?
